Companies may be putting their data at risk by using downloadable desktop search products to deal with large amounts of data, a Forrester analyst has warned.
A report by Leslie Owens has told companies to adopt enterprise-worthy desktop search tools, reports CIO magazine.
In a survey of 565 people who use computers at work, 32 per cent said they had downloaded desktop search software.
Ms Owens believed that consumers like this software because pre-installed search tools prove inadequate.
'People are just looking for productivity enhancers because there is just so much information to look through,' she told the magazine.
However, using these tools can be dangerous, with Ms Owens citing a few examples.
Email discovery can become difficult, because of email replication required by the software.
